Меню Рубрики

Windows 10 iot rdp

Что такое Windows 10 IoT

Microsoft предлагает Windows 10 в девяти отдельных выпусках, начиная с домашней версии и заканчивая корпоративной. Windows 10 IoT («Интернет вещей») — это издание, которым Вы, скорее всего, не обладаете, но которое Вы, вероятно, использовали чаще, чем представляете себе.

Windows 10 IoT выросла из Windows Embedded

Windows 10 IoT — это эволюция более ранней версии Windows — Windows Embedded. Вы можете вспомнить банкоматы под управлением Windows XP и нуждающихся в серьезном обновлении. Эти банкоматы и другие подобные устройства работали под управлением Windows Embedded (XPe). Это урезанная версия операционной системы Windows, которая будет хорошо работать на менее мощном оборудовании, использовать один сценарий использования или оба варианта.

Банк может использовать эту ОС для банкомата, розничный торговец может использовать ее для системы POS (точки продажи), а производитель может использовать ее для простого прототипа устройства. Однако Windows IoT — это не просто переименованная версия Windows для использования Интернета вещей, и не только для предприятий и крупных корпораций. Это очевидно в двух разных версиях ОС, IOT Enterprise и IoT Core.

IoT Enterprise предназначен для использования с несколькими устройствами

Microsoft предлагает Windows 10 IoT в двух вариантах: Enterprise и Core. Корпоративная версия по сути Windows 10 Enterprise, но с дополнительными элементами управления блокировкой. С помощью этих элементов управления, например, Вы можете заставить Windows отображать одно приложение для киоска. Windows по-прежнему будет работать в фоновом режиме, но обычные пользователи не должны иметь доступ к этим службам. Если Вы подошли к киоску регистрации и заметили, что приложение для регистрации не работает, и Windows 10 уже видна, Вы, вероятно, столкнулись с Windows 10 IoT Enterprise.

Как и в Windows 10 Enterprise, Вы не можете купить лицензию для IoT Enterprise в магазине. Microsoft распространяет лицензии через партнеров по перепродаже и OEM-соглашения. Поскольку это полная версия Windows, Вы получаете всю мощь, которая прилагается к ней, но есть один существенный недостаток: IoT Enterprise не будет работать на процессорах ARM.

IoT Core предназначен для простых плат, индивидуальных программ и датчиков

IoT Core это урезанная версия. Вы не получаете полный опыт Windows Shell; вместо этого ОС может запускать только одно приложение универсальной программы Windows (UWP) и фоновые процессы. Однако IoT Core будет работать на процессорах ARM. Вы бы выбрали IOT Core для запуска простых программ, которые могут не требовать столько непосредственного взаимодействия с пользователем. Например, термостат Glas использует IoT Core. А благодаря совместимости с ARM Вы можете запускать IoT Core на простых платах, таких как Raspberry Pi .

Эта особенность делает IoT Core отличным выбором для быстрых прототипов для производителей или одноразовых проектов для любителей. Hackster , сообщество разработчиков аппаратного и программного обеспечения, содержит немало уникальных примеров IoT Core, в том числе дверь с распознаванием домашних животных , дверь с распознаванием лиц , информационную панель smarthome и волшебное зеркало . Это все проекты, которые Вы могли бы построить самостоятельно, если у Вас есть необходимые навыки. Microsoft даже продемонстрировала робота на базе Raspberry Pi , который использовал Windows IOT и взаимодействовал с голограммами. Он предоставляет необходимые ресурсы, поэтому Вы можете загрузить IoT Core для личного использования с бесплатной лицензией.

Кроме того, IoT Core на Raspberry Pi или Minnowboard может быть соединен с датчиками и механизмами, такими как камеры, PIR-датчики, сервоприводы и температурные датчики для расширенного использования. Это, в свою очередь, позволяет Windows 10 передавать данные, собранные этими датчиками, что является основной предпосылкой Интернета вещей.

Windows IoT — это вариант с закрытым исходным кодом для разработчиков Visual Studio

Вам может быть интересно, почему кто-то использует Windows IoT вместо альтернатив, таких как Linux или Android. Большая часть этого сводится к тому, для чего или для кого предназначено устройство и кто занимается программированием.

Преимущества открытого исходного кода, такие как варианты лицензирования и настройки, часто рекламируются как замечательные вещи — и это так. Но открытый исходный код не лучший выбор для всех сценариев сценариев. Иногда для конкретных проектов требуется программное обеспечение с закрытым исходным кодом (или проприетарное). Некоторые предприятия и правительства (в лучшую или в худшую сторону) также прямо запрещают использование программного обеспечения с открытым исходным кодом в своих покупках. Даже если компания не запрещает ПО с открытым исходным кодом, оно может быть неофициально осуждено. Если Вы производитель и способны работать с любым из этих вариантов, Вы будете использовать все, что порадует Вашего клиента.

Но если оставить в стороне эти дебаты с открытым исходным кодом и проприетарным программным обеспечением, у некоторых людей есть еще одно явное преимущество. Windows 10 IoT связывается с Visual Studio, и Вы можете использовать эту среду разработки для разработки программ для нее. Фактически, IoT Core спроектирован так, чтобы работать без графического интерфейса и будет подключаться к другому компьютеру с Windows 10 для программирования и обратной связи. Если Вы все равно проводите большую часть времени разработки в Visual Studio, выбор IoT для Windows 10 вместо альтернативы может сэкономить время на обучение и настройку. Вы сможете сразу же использовать весь свой опыт.

Обычный пользователь, вероятно, не будет загружать и использовать IoT для Windows 10, но это не значит, что он не столкнется с этим. По большей части, если Вы не разработчик, эта ОС работает для Вас так, что Вы можете даже не заметить. Это может быть питание киоска, который Вы использовали для заказа еды в ресторане, или приготовления коктейля. Даже если Вы разработчик, и Вы не хотите тратить время на изучение альтернативы, такой как Linux, Windows 10 IoT может быть лучшим вариантом для Вашего следующего проекта.

Источник

Enabling Remote Desktop on a Windows 10 IoT Core Device

If you are operating Raspberry Pi 3 running Windows 10 IoT headlessly (without a display) then you normally manage your device from a SSH or PowerShell session. However if you need to see the display (user interface) of an app that is running on the device then you can make use of the new remote desktop and sensor technology that is available on Windows 10 IoT Core OS. This feature lets you remotely view the UI of a Windows 10 IoT device from another computer running Windows 10. All you need to do is enable the Windows IoT remote server on your IoT device and install the free Remote Client on the Windows 10 PC that you are connecting from.

Enabling Windows IoT Remote Server

To enable Windows IoT Remote Server:

  1. Open Windows IoT Core Dashboard.
  2. Click My Devices.
  3. Right click on your device from device list and select Open in Device Portal.
  4. Alternatively, if you already know the IP address of your device, open a web browser and navigate to the url http://your-IP-address:8080/
  5. Enter username and password when prompted.
  6. In Device Portal, click Remote.

Windows IoT Remote Client

Windows IoT Remote Client is a free app available on Microsoft Store and can run on a desktop PC, tablet or phone. The client app will automatically discover Windows Iot Devices on the network. You can select a discovered device or enter the IP address and connect.

Input from mouse, keyboard or touch and data from any sensors are send to the Windows IoT device and the display from the device is transmitted back to the client.

Windows IoT Remote Display

Источник

Windows 10 iot rdp

Let us know when you write a RDP client for it.

It should be possible I think. Not sure how it would work performance wise. According to the release notes they still don’t have the video driver ready, that might improve performance.

Re: Remote Desktop from IOT Core

Ok i know that this is not a every day windows 10 desktop version but as i know you can install one universal app and install some background processes.

Now there is 2 questions. Is the windows remote desktop app an universal app. Also can you install app over visual studio or can you do it over the windows store.

This is a great way to create a good and chip thin client.

Re: Remote Desktop from IOT Core

Your question has been answered, including by a microsoft rep.

YOU CANNOT RDP FROM a Pi2B running Win10IOT to another computer. PERIOD.

(Until such time as someone writes an universal RDP client)

You can try asking another 1000 different ways, the answer will be the same.

Now if you install Raspbian instead, it is very easy

after installing Raspbian, just open a terminal, and type

sudo apt-get install remmina

Presto! You can RDP to other computers

a_varnaliev wrote: Ok i know that this is not a every day windows 10 desktop version but as i know you can install one universal app and install some background processes.

Now there is 2 questions. Is the windows remote desktop app an universal app. Also can you install app over visual studio or can you do it over the windows store.

This is a great way to create a good and chip thin client.

Re: Remote Desktop from IOT Core

There is an official RDP client in the Windows Store — and it is a Universal App. So almost all of the pieces are in place. At some point, assuming Windows 10 IoT gains the ability to install apps from the Windows Store, it may be possible.

There is a Windows 10 IoT Thin Client edition available for licensing in large volumes to OEMs, so there is already a working RDP client and this is probably it. Dell (Wyse) has a Windows 10 IoT thin client already released and other vendors will be close behind.

However, with respect to installing/testing it on the Raspberry Pi. there is no easy way to install it at the moment since Windows 10 IoT only allows manual install of an Appx file and does not provide access to the Windows Store (and who knows if the RDP client app actually would be fully working, even if you get past these hurdles). It certainly isn’t a ‘supported’ configuration at the moment.

Источник

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

  • Windows 10 iot orangepi
  • Windows 10 iot enterprise mobile
  • Windows 10 iot core version 1703
  • Windows 10 iot core for raspberry pi 3
  • Windows 10 iot core dashboard установка